The Visionist. She has been dreaming!-and her thoughts are still, On their far journey, in the land of dreams! The forms we call-but may not chase at will, And soft, low voices,-sweet as distant streams, Heard in the night-hush,-linger round her heart! T.K. Hervey.
M. Gauci lithog.
London: Printed & Published for the Proprietor by Engelmann, Graf, Coindet & Co. 92, Dean St. Soho 1828.
Lithograph. India 267 x 204mm. 10½ x 8". Some scuffing.
Thomas Kibble Hervey was a British poet and critic, this being an illustration to one of his verses. Maxim Gauci a Lithographer born in Malta, father of Paul Gauci and William Gauci who settled in London in 1809 building up a very fine business and reputation which the sons then continued.
